We need to find some records, save result in the separate View. You can export to Excel all database records or use Search, Filtering, Grouping functions and export only the found records. It's very easy. See the screenshots below.
Create database Views for the results of:


For example we have UEFA Country Ranking online database.
The first step: open our test database (UEFA Country Ranking). There are 53 records and go to the Records menu.

We need to find and save all the countries whose ranking is greater than 30 in a separate table.
How to save search results: After the search click on button "Save result" to create a new widget (view) with the found records. Widget's name is automatically set.

The drop-down list will appear with a widget's name. You can select a widget or delete it. Also you always can add a new record to the new widget or edit / delete the existing record.

To export new database widget records you only need to click on button "Export to Excel". See the screenshots below.

All your found records are in the excel file.

How to save results after filtering: you must do the same steps. Click on green button "Save result" and you records will be saved in the new widget.

Select a needed widget from the widget's list to continue working or delete it.

After filtering all the found records can be exported to an Excel file. You only need to click twice with your mouse.

After using the grouping function you can save a widget and work with the records.

See a short manual of how to reorder views in a list:

It's very useful if you need to sort and show the created views by date, for example.

We have a database "UEFA Country Ranking 2011" and several views in a list. We need to reorder these views.

Find (see the screenshot below) and click on the icon to reorder the views you have created.

Using drag & drop interface you can reorder the views you need.

As a result we have changed the views list.
